Transaction 62ffdd3d53949dbe747253928402c87c79bf4eaea158b48178ddf83766c93a74

3 Input
2 Outputs
  • 62ffdd3d53949dbe747253928402c87c79bf4eaea158b48178ddf83766c93a74:0
  • value  8550000
    address  1LLWQ9K4XQi7tdP6k56eVLpQJyf7yqHUN9
  • 62ffdd3d53949dbe747253928402c87c79bf4eaea158b48178ddf83766c93a74:1
  • value  9263
    address  1HySCBn4MmQ5gcksSgGC4K8LKmTHXTujLa